Czech Man Arrested for Holding Woman Captive and Assaulting Her for Months

A 27-year-old woman escaped after three months of captivity in a basement, leading to the arrest of a 40-year-old suspect west of Prague.

Overview

  • The suspect, a 40-year-old man, is accused of imprisoning and repeatedly assaulting a 27-year-old woman in a basement for approximately three months.
  • The victim managed to escape through a window and sought help from a neighbor in a village 70 kilometers west of Prague.
  • Police have charged the suspect with unlawful imprisonment, sexual assault, and coercion, with a potential sentence of up to 12 years if convicted.
  • The victim, found malnourished and in poor physical condition, is now receiving psychological support.
